When acting as the Contract Management Referent, he/she ensures that the Group policy in terms of Contract Management is well known and implemented in the Operating Centre he is responsible for. He/she:

  • Ensures compliance with internal policies, standards, processes and the like.
  • Brings methodology and provide food for thought to the operating people.
  • Protects and pursues T.EN’s interests and contractual rights.
  • Maintains T.EN’s liability exposure under strict control.
  • As appropriate, may develop the local contract management team (adapts the team to the needs with either internal or external resources)

When acting as operational Contract Manager on projects, he/she advises the Project Manager on contract strategy and ensures contract management activities all along projects. He/she :

  • Is responsible for the delivery of contract management services and strategy from early projects phase until contract close outs.
  • Provides the principal contract support and leads the contract management activities (including client contracts and potential partnership arrangements (such as JV, Consortium), when applicable).
  • Prepares and consolidates complex analysis of contract conditions, risks and opportunities, and develop associated contractual strategy.
  • Deals with contractual issues, anticipates risks and grasp opportunities.
  • Manages the interface between the project and the other legal functions.
  • Manages a small team: depending on assignment and profile, the function may include management of a contract engineer.

Job Accountabilities :The Contract Manager & Operating Centre Referent will be directly involved in the Operating Centre projects, encompassing FEED (Front End Engineering Design), EPs/Cm (Engineering and Procurement services / Construction management) projects, mainly under reimbursable scheme (sometimes lump-sum). Scopes of such projects extend from Energies (Liquefied Natural Gas, Green H2, bio jet) to Chemistry (Polyolefins, Plastic Recycling, bio chemicals) and Pharmaceutics, with multiple different clients.The Contract Manager & Operating Centre Referent:

  • Is the focal point on Contract Management topics for Operating Centre Senior Management.
  • Implements locally the Group Contract Management processes, rules & tools.
  • Sensibilizes, trains and educates Operating Centre staff to the Contract Management.
  • Collects feedbacks from Operating Centre staff on their contractual issues and actively share lessons learnt and/or prepare and present analyses to address them.
  • Participates to the COMOP meetings to review the mains issues of the Operating Centre’s projects.
  • Works closely with Paris Operating Centre bringing Group processes and methodologies.

At the early phase of the project, the Contract Manager & Operating Centre Referent shall:

  • Prepare (or support the preparation of) a consolidated analysis of the Contract Terms and Conditions to highlight the areas of risks and opportunities to be pursued.
  • Develop and/or review critical project specific procedures.
  • Monitor timely adherence to contract provisions (insurances, bonds, certifications, operational, etc) and coordinate any actions required in this regards with other T.EN departments.

During the project development, the Contract Manager & Operating Centre Referent shall:

  • Provide appropriate support and guidance to the Project Manager and leadership within the Project team in the management and administration of the contract, consistently with the relevant policies, standards and processes.
  • Participate in project meetings (including Monthly Project Reviews), as appropriate.
  • Initiate, draft and/or review, as the case may be, all incoming and outgoing correspondence with clients, partners and, where applicable, with third parties.
  • Initiate and coordinate the preparation, negotiation and settlement of change orders, extension and time, and claims towards the client.
  • Keep an eye on the schedule performance and cost trends in order to identify risks and opportunities for revenue enhancement, schedule relief and risks mitigation.
  • Assist the procurement/purchasing team on critical matters (consistency between purchasing General Terms and Conditions and the prime contract, complex clause analyses, correspondences drafting, amendment, claims, etc…).
  • Administer and protect T.EN contractual and commercial interests vis-à-vis project partners (when applicable).
  • Liaise and obtain when required legal expertise from the Legal Team (corporate, compliance, Intellectual property, insurance, litigation, general legal advice), from other functions (treasury, tax, etc.) or from external advisors with the purpose of providing the project team with a comprehensive set of legal and contractual services.
